Issue #16757 has been updated by matz (Yukihiro Matsumoto). Status changed from Open to Closed Closing this issue. We have accepted `Range#clamp` (#22175), which covers the main use case here: restricting a range to given bounds. For overlapping ranges it gives the same result as an intersection would. I do not want to add a general `Range#intersection` (or `Range#&`). It raises semantic questions with no obviously right answer, such as what to return for disjoint ranges (`nil`, an empty range, or an exception). More fundamentally, it frames Range as a set-like collection, which invites `Range#union` next, and union of two ranges cannot be defined in general because the result may be discontiguous. I prefer to keep Range out of set algebra. I wrote a method recently to solve this but it gets complicated and doesn't solve for all edge cases. The example I was using it for was getting the intersection of two date ranges. I was using it to calculate pricing discounts for overlapping dates for a reservation system. I would propose something like: ``` ruby (Date.new(2020, 04, 03)..Date.new(2020, 04, 20)) & (Date.new(2020, 04, 15)..Date.new(2020, 04, 30)) => Wed, 15 Apr 2020..Mon, 20 Apr 2020 ``` There are a handful of array methods that you can just convert a range to and do on an arrays rather than the ranges themselves, like so: ``` ruby (Date.new(2020, 04, 03)..Date.new(2020, 04, 20)).to_a & (Date.new(2020, 04, 15)..Date.new(2020, 04, 30)).to_a => [Wed, 15 Apr 2020, Thu, 16 Apr 2020, Fri, 17 Apr 2020, Sat, 18 Apr 2020, Sun, 19 Apr 2020, Mon, 20 Apr 2020] ``` There are a few issues with this however: 1. Performance: creating the ranges into arrays and doing array calculations can me slower based on the span of the range. 2. Returning a range: if you want to go back to a range, you need to convert the resulting array back to a range, which involves min and maxing the array and handling nil edge cases. 3. Infinite ranges: Now that there are endless and beginless ranges added in ruby 2.6 and 2.7 respectively, you can not convert an infinite range to an array and therefore can't do an intersection without more complex logic. I think the added infinite range support makes it a good reason to add range intersections since that is a feature you can't accomplish with just an array.
